Inspector Lee is an advanced technical singletrack trail that breaks off from upper Big Ern shortly after you head into the woods. A quick traverse just after a left-hand berm will lead you to the top of the trail. The upper section of Inspector Lee is steep and heads straight downhill. It starts off with a drop, a few tight, loose, and steep corners. After crossing the road, the trail again has an optional drop and continues steeply down the fall line. It will begin to ease up in steepness and weave through the trees with a few small log drops along the way. The final section of the trail is where things get a bit more technical. The trail weaves down a steep gully that is very rocky and loose that requires tight maneuvers, and off camber rocky riding. Once you’ve exited the gully, you’ll begin to work your way back to the lift where the last bit of technical riding has multiple line options. Jump back on Big Ern and head back up for another lap
